Description

Small-size garlic combine
Technical Field
The invention relates to the field of economic crop harvesting, in particular to a small garlic combine harvester.
Background
Garlic is a labor-intensive cultivation crop, the problems of high labor intensity of manual operation, much time occupation, strong harvest seasonality, large harvest loss, low efficiency and the like exist in the harvest process, the main problem influencing the production development and industrial growth of the garlic is that the integration degree of a harvesting machine is low, a plurality of processes still need to be participated by manpower, the efficiency is low, the harvest loss is large due to unreasonable structure and the like.
The applicant has proposed application No. 2020213553348 and discloses a self-propelled large and small row garlic combine harvester, which solves the above problems to some extent, but the current garlic planting is usually in the form of interplanting, such as garlic and cotton in Shandong Jinxiang county, and garlic and pepper are interplanted at intervals, in view of economic benefit, pest control and the like. In which case large mechanical automated harvesting is difficult to perform.
Disclosure of Invention
The invention aims to overcome the defects of the prior art and provide a small garlic combine harvester which has the advantages of high integration degree, reasonable arrangement of unit structures, small harvesting interval and small whole width, is arranged at the front part of a vehicle body, is controlled by hands in feeding, avoids the serious garlic injury problem caused by dragging operation of the traditional agricultural machine, can realize the operations of digging, soil removal, clamping and conveying, seedling cutting, garlic head collection and the like, and has the characteristics of simple structure, convenient use and the like.
The equipment comprises a chassis and a frame, wherein travelling wheels are arranged at the bottom of the chassis, and a power system is arranged on the side edge of the frame and drives a harvester to travel through the power system and supplies energy to a harvesting unit;
the frame is an assembly foundation of the equipment, the handrail is arranged at the rear part of the frame, and the advancing direction is controlled by the hand of an operator;
a harvesting unit is arranged on the main body part of the frame and comprises a clamping and conveying device arranged on a chassis, and a digging shovel extending forwards to the front of the clamping and conveying device is arranged in the middle of the clamping device and below the chassis;
a grain lifting device, a depth limiting wheel and a grain pulling device are arranged on a frame body of the clamping and conveying device; the grain lifting device, the depth wheel and the grain pulling device are arranged in sequence from front to back;
the clamping and conveying device is a single conveying channel clamping and conveying device formed by two conveying belts, and the digging shovel is correspondingly arranged according to the width of the device and the reel device; namely, the garlic planting width is set corresponding to two rows of garlic planting widths;
the bottom of the rear part of the clamping and conveying device is provided with a seedling cutting device, and the lower part of the seedling cutting device is provided with a bag hanging device.
Further, a supporting plate is integrally arranged on the rack, is arranged below the bag hanging device and corresponds to the position of the hanging bag.
Furthermore, the grain lifting device comprises a floating rod, a grain guiding rod and a mounting bracket. The mounting bracket is assembled on a fixed bracket at the front end of the clamping and conveying device, the floating rod is movably hinged on the mounting bracket, a depth limiting wheel is arranged below the mounting bracket, the mounting bracket is hinged with the lower part of the fixed bracket at the front end of the clamping and conveying device, and the mounting bracket is connected with the upper part of the fixed bracket at the front end of the clamping and conveying device through a bidirectional adjusting bolt.
Furthermore, the power system can adopt a diesel engine or a gasoline engine, and the arrangement position of the power system is positioned at one side of the frame, namely one side of the clamping and conveying device. The power system is in power connection with the travelling wheels and the harvesting unit.
